Momentum Product Design - Industrial Design and Product Development
Momentum Product Design - Industrial Design and Product Development Momentum Product Design is an award-winning industrial design and development firm in Ottawa, Canada. Innovation in high-value consumer electronics. Momentum Product Design is an award-winning industrial design and development firm in Ottawa, Canada. Innovation in high-value consumer electronics.